The Alaska Lumber Grading Program provides a certification course to allow small and medium-scale sawmill operators to produce dimension lumber for home construction in Alaska. When the program's conditions are met, the lumber may be accepted as an alternative to grade-stamped lumber for structural applications where required by residential building codes.

Learn about the significant changes the Alaska Department of Environmental Conservation made to the cottage food industry. The rules were significantly expanded in 2024 and are now known as the Homemade Food Exemption.
Sarah Lewis, UAF Cooperative Extension Service health, home and family development agent, will explain the changes. If you have a Homemade Foods business, would like to start one, or might sell homemade foods through your market, knowledge of the new rules will help ensure you're in compliance. It's important to understand the risks and opportunities associated with selling either potentially harmful or nonpotentially harmful foods from a home-based business. Alaska and Polar Regions Collections & Archives- Open House
The Alaska and Polar Regions Collections and Archives at the University of Fairbanks Alaska will be hosting an Open House on Oct. 16 from 4-7 p.m.
We'll be displaying highlights from our collections for the public and University to come in and view.
Our theme for the year is Dog Mushing, titled Breaking Trail: History, Heritage and Huskies is the 100th Anniversary of the 1925 Diphtheria, Serum Run to Nome, the event that for which legendary dog Togo would become famous for.
We'll be featuring the collections of our own departments, like Photos & Manuscripts, Rare Books & Maps, Alaskana, Film, Oral History, and Native Languages as well as special guests like our University of Alaska Museum of the North and Eielson Air Force Base's Historian. dis/comfort in the North
dis/comfort in the North features more than 50 artists from 16 countries. Selected through a call for submissions and by invitation, artists share encounters and intimacies with the North through video, photography, carving, embroidery, an interactive card game, a protest speech, and two-dimensional works printed on photo transparencies. A range of experiences and stories unfold, asking viewers to consider their own dis/comfort and reflect on the broader contexts of how comfort shapes living in and visiting the North. Curated by master’s student Katie Ione Craney, this exhibition is a project for the Arctic & Northern Studies program.

Join ORCA POD Peer Prevention Educators for this Zine Workshop. Learn to create your own zines, small booklets between 8 and 32 pages long often illustrated with imagery and poetry, etc. Dating back to the 19th century, these charming folded-paper books, called chapbooks were inspired by popular culture and were perfect for mixing visual art and written texts. In the 1970's the zine was coopted by the young punk movement as a way to disseminate information on various punk bands and other information including poetry and photocopy imagery. In this workshop, we will write from prompts and exercises to produce fragments of poetry and prose then blend with stamping, drawing, painting, and collage techniques to make our own individual zines sewn by machine, hand or stapled. "A Nineteenth-Century Chukchi Collection in Munich: Modern Reflections from the Chukotkan Community
Researchers Liliya Zdor, Irina Nutetgivev, Mark Zdor, and Eduard Zdor discuss a 2024 collaborative project examining how contemporary Chukchi communities interpret historical objects from the Munich Museum’s Chukchi collection. Working with native speakers and cultural experts, the team produced bilingual Chukchi–Russian materials and multimedia recordings that reveal shifting worldviews and renewed cultural connections.

MA Thesis Defense: Everyday Life in the Work of Virginia Woolf
This MA thesis defense examines how Woolf’s fiction and essays portray the texture of ordinary experience—what she called “moments of non-being” or the “cotton wool” of daily life. Through close readings of The Years, Mrs. Dalloway, The Waves, and To the Lighthouse, the project argues that Woolf’s focus on the mundane highlights its psychological and gendered dimensions, revealing that life’s richness resides as much in the everyday as in the extraordinary.

Webinar: Using Kelp as Fertilizer
Erin Oliver, a postdoctoral researcher with Washington State University and a USDA Climate Hub Fellow for Alaska Agriculture stationed in Palmer, will discuss lab and field studies conducted at Matanuska Experiment Farm to investigate the effects of kelp on soil health and crop production in a free webinar.
Kelp shows great promise for improving soil health and crop production in Alaska. Potential benefits include increased nutrient availability, improved soil pH, increased seed germination rates, and increased crop biomass.
Using Alaska-grown kelp in agricultural soils provides both economic benefits for the mariculture industry and an alternative to commercial, inorganic fertilizers produced outside of Alaska. Studies have found that the benefits of kelp vary by soil type and amendment rates, but little research has been done in Alaska on this subject.
